Overview

Muscle titanium wire is a precision-engineered medical device component, crafted from high-performance titanium alloys like Ti-6Al-4V. Developed specifically for surgical applications, it combines exceptional mechanical properties with biological inertness, making it ideal for long-term implantation. Unlike conventional steel wires, titanium variants eliminate risks of allergic reactions and MRI interference while offering superior strength-to-weight ratios. The wire's diameter typically ranges from 0.5mm to 2.0mm, with surface treatments often applied to enhance tissue compatibility.

Structure and Working Principle

The wire's effectiveness stems from its metallurgical composition and cold-working process. Ti-6Al-4V alloy contains 6% aluminum and 4% vanadium, which create an alpha-beta phase structure for optimal strength and fatigue resistance. During surgical procedures, surgeons utilize the wire's flexibility to contour around anatomical structures before securing it through twisting or specialized crimping techniques. The material's shape memory characteristics allow for precise tension adjustment post-implantation, crucial for proper bone alignment and healing.

Key Features

Biocompatibility stands as the most critical feature, with titanium demonstrating exceptional osseointegration capabilities. The wire's oxide layer prevents ion release and maintains stability in bodily fluids. Mechanically, these wires exhibit tensile strengths exceeding 900 MPa while maintaining ductility for surgical manipulation. Surface modifications like anodization can further enhance antibacterial properties and radiopacity for post-operative monitoring.

Application Areas

Primary applications include orthopedic fracture fixation, particularly in sternal closure after cardiac surgery and patellar tendon repairs. Dental surgeons use finer gauges for orthodontic archwires and periodontal ligament stabilization. Emerging applications include robotic-assisted surgeries where the wire's consistent mechanical properties enable precise computer-controlled tensioning. Veterinary medicine also employs similar products for animal fracture management.

Pre-implantation sterilization follows strict protocols, typically using autoclaving at 134°C for 18 minutes or gamma irradiation. Improper sterilization may compromise surface properties. Storage requires dry, room-temperature conditions in original sterile packaging. Manufacturers recommend inspecting for kinks or surface irregularities before use, as these may indicate material fatigue or contamination.

B2B Procurement Guide

Medical device manufacturers should prioritize suppliers with ISO 13485 certification and FDA 510(k) clearance for orthopedic wires. Batch-specific material certificates should verify compliance with ASTM F136 standards. Consider minimum order quantities (MOQs) ranging from 100-500 units for standard diameters. Some manufacturers offer custom spool lengths and packaging configurations for high-volume surgical centers. Lead times typically range from 4-8 weeks for specialized orders.
